What is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co Debt-to-Asset?

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co AMM:PIEC 91 Debt-to-Asset is 0.03 as of Jun. 2026. GuruFocus rates AMM:PIEC with a GF Score™ of 91/100 and a GF Value™ of JOD2.29 (Significantly Overvalued). The stock has 4 warning signs investors should review.

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co's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 was JOD0.82 Mil.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 was JOD0.00 Mil.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ease ObligationTotal Assets for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 was JOD32.03 Mil.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co's debt to asset for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 was 0.03.


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co  (AMM:PIEC) Debt-to-Asset Explanation

In the calculation of Debt-to-Asset, we use the total of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ation divided by Total Assets.

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co Business Description

Address University of Jordan street, P.O. Box: 1101, Abu Al-Haj Commercial Complex, Amman, JOR, 11910
Philadelphia International Educational Investment Co operates in the education sector. The group offers undergraduate studies and graduate studies in the fields of business, arts, engineering, information technology, pharmacy, science, law, and nursing. The company's main operations are providing educational services inside the Hashemite Kingdom of Jordan.
